Cristi Balaj (54 years old) announced that he has resigned as president of the club CFR Cluj. The former Romanian referee had taken over the post on November 4, 2021, after giving up the head of the National Anti-Doping Agency (ANAD).
The separation was also confirmed by the club's financier, Ioan Varga. Thus, Balaj leaves CFR Cluj after almost 4 years of collaboration.

Cristi Balaj wanted to resign in 2024
The former referee recently confessed that he intends to leave CFR Cluj. In fact, Cristi Balaj had threatened with resignation in April last year, after CFR was eliminated from the “quarters” of the Romanian Cup, being humiliated with a score of 0-4 by the second division, the Corvin, which would win the trophy.
That match recorded the resignation from the position of coach of Adrian Mutu, a technician whose team was not approved by the president. However, Neluțu Varga managed to return Balaj to return.
CFR Cluj has a disastrous start of the season. The vice-champion has lost the Romanian Super Cup, played with FCSB, score 1-2, and was left without Dan Petrescu, who resigned after the humility in Sweden, with Hacken, score 2-7, in the Conference League preliminaries.
Without participation in European cups this season, the situation is also terrible in the championship. Meanwhile by Andrea Mandorini, CFR Cluj has only succeeded in 11 stages, and is 12th, with 12 points.
